Understanding the Nine of Swords
The Nine of Swords is often considered a negative card due to its graphic representation and the general traits associated with it. It symbolizes tribulations, accidents, and even paranoia. However, it’s important to remember that the source of these struggles lies within ourselves. Therefore, it becomes crucial to learn how to control our minds.
The woman depicted in the card, sitting on her bed with a deep anguish after waking up from a nightmare, represents the darkness. It highlights the power of intellect and thought, as it belongs to the suit of Swords.

Astrologically, the Nine of Swords is associated with the sign of Gemini and the planet Mars. It is also dominated by the element of air.
Regarding combinations with the Nine of Swords, when it appears with The Chariot, it suggests that moving forward requires addressing the past. In combination with the Ten of Cups, it indicates the return of happiness. With the Three of Pentacles, it symbolizes overcoming fears and the return of love. If combined with Justice, it implies a divorce. When reversed with The Judgment, serenity will return, while its combination with the Page of Pentacles suggests that a friend’s actions may endanger us.
The symbolic representation of this particular card reveals the nine swords hanging behind the woman, representing the burdens and anguish. The design of the blanket consists of roses, representing love, while the soft tones allude to hope.

The Nine of Swords in the Rider Waite Tarot Deck
The Nine of Swords in the Rider Waite Tarot deck is one of the most challenging cards. It is dominated by the image of a figure sitting on a bed, covered by a blanket with nine swords hanging on the wall behind them.
The Nine of Swords is traditionally associated with stress, anxiety, and fear. This card may indicate that you are struggling with your own thoughts and worries, and these issues may be affecting your sleep and peace of mind.
In a Rider Waite Tarot reading, the appearance of the Nine of Swords may be a sign that you need to confront your fears and worries instead of avoiding them. Often, problems that seem enormous in the darkness of the night are manageable in the light of day.
The Nine of Swords may also suggest that you are being too hard on yourself. It may be a sign that you need to be kinder to yourself and recognize that everyone makes mistakes and faces challenges.
In summary, the Nine of Swords is a card of introspection and self-reflection. Although it can be difficult to face our fears and worries, it is often the first step toward overcoming these challenges.
